pqr Posted February 6, 2011 Share Posted February 6, 2011 Screenwriter David Seidler said the royal approval was the ultimate honour. The Queen Mother, who was married to King George VI, once asked Mr Seidler not to make the film, our correspondent added. "When her mother asked me 30 years ago to wait, because the memory of these events were still too painful, I understood the intense feelings that were involved," he said. "And now that the film has been written and made with love, and respect, and admiration, the fact that Her Majesty has recognised this is incredibly and wonderfully gratifying."
